A pattern, however, is defined by its duration, which analysts rarely know in advance. To resolve this unknown duration, an interval of window lengths is defined, and the accepted method is to try every length in that interval. Existing pan matrix profile (PMP) methods compute one z-normalized matrix profile per length, so $L$ lengths cost $L$ quadratic self-joins over the same series.
